Two withdraw, 173 in fray for 1st phase
Source: Chronicle News Service
Imphal, February 11 2022:
Following withdrawal of nomination papers by two candidates, altogether 173 candidates are now in fray from 38 assembly constituencies which will go to the polls in the first phase of the 12th Manipur Legislative Assembly election on February 28 .
On the last day of withdrawal of nomination papers on Friday, Independent candidate Pukhrambam Somojit Singh from Langthabal AC and another Independent candidate Thangmilien Kipgen from Kangpokpi AC withdrew their nominations.
With Somojit's withdrawal, Langthabal AC has now only four candidates in fray and they are Okram Joy Singh of INC, Karam Shyam of BJP, Karam Nabakrshor Singh of NPP and Independent candidate Hijam Somarendro Singh.
Pukhrambam Somojit submitted for withdrawal of his candidature at the office of Returning Officer Scindia Laipubam around 1.20 pm Friday.
After withdrawing his candidature, Somojit told media persons at Imphal Hotel that he had worked for BJP for more than 20 years and sought BJP ticket with high hope of getting the same.
However, the party did not issue ticket on certain ground and he decided to contest the election as an Independent candidate as per wishes of his supporters and people of the constituency.
Amidst the preparation to contest election, some BJP leaders advised him not to waste 20 years of his hard work for the party abruptly and stay connected with the party to continue serving people without contesting election and accordingly he withdrew his candidature, Somojit said and appealed to people of the constituency not to take the decision otherwise and promised to work together with the people further.
Meanwhile, a DIPR report said that altogether 55 candidates will be contesting in the first-phase election in Imphal West district.
BJP and INC are fielding candidates in all 13 ACs in the district, NPP in 11 ACs while Janata Dal (United) fielded candidates in 9 ACs.
NCP is contesting from two ACs, Shiv Sena and the Republican Party of India (Athawale) from one AC each in the district.
